What is a polynomial?

Back

A polynomial is a mathematical expression that consists of variables, coefficients, and non-negative integer exponents, combined using addition, subtraction, and multiplication.

What is the degree of a polynomial?

Back

The degree of a polynomial is the highest power of the variable in the expression.

How do you simplify the expression (-10a^4 - 7a^2 + 11) - (9 + 10a^2 - 5a^4)?

Back

To simplify, combine like terms: -10a^4 + 5a^4 - 7a^2 - 10a^2 + 11 - 9 = -5a^4 - 17a^2 + 2.

What is the difference of cubes formula?

Back

The difference of cubes formula states that a^3 - b^3 = (a - b)(a^2 + ab + b^2).

What is the first step in factoring a polynomial?

Back

The first step in factoring a polynomial is to look for a common factor in all terms.

How do you factor the expression 2x^3 + 5x^2 - 8x - 20 completely?

Back

To factor completely, group the terms: (2x^3 + 5x^2) + (-8x - 20) = x^2(2x + 5) - 4(2x + 5) = (x - 2)(x + 2)(2x + 5).

What is the result of factoring x^3 - 27?

Back

Factoring x^3 - 27 gives (x - 3)(x^2 + 3x + 9) using the difference of cubes formula.
